Charlestown, Nebraska

Charleston is a ghost town in York County, Nebraska, United States.

[1] Charleston (also spelled Charlestown) was platted in 1887.

[2] Charles A. McCloud, for whom the community was named, was instrumental in bringing in the railroad to the area.

[3][4] A post office was established in Charleston in 1888, and remained in operation until it was discontinued in 1941.
